Ronnie O'Sullivan was again unhappy with someone in the crowd as he complained about a security guard in the World Championship final. It is the fifth occasion in O’Sullivan’s illustrious career that he has occupied the world No. 1 ranking, and the first time since 2019, as he continues his pursuit of a record-equalling seventh world title.
Ronnie O'Sullivan taking on Judd Trump in the World Championship final at the Crucible is the match that Eurosport expert Alan McManus has waited for «for 10 years» — and he has explained why. It is a mouthwatering encounter in Sheffield with world No. 1 O'Sullivan, who is seeking to equal Stephen Hendry's record of Crucible triumphs, taking on a player who has been a dominant force in snooker for years in Trump.

Ronnie O’Sullivan triumphed over John Higgins in a 17-11 semi-final victory to set up a final showdown with Judd Trump – we look ahead to the match and what’s at stake – both financially and historically.
Ronnie O’Sullivan has admitted that he needs to be playing well to win tournaments, whereas in previous years he has got over the line when being below his best. O’Sullivan advanced to his eighth World Championship final with a win over John Higgins, and he has produced some of his best snooker of the season over the past fortnight at the Crucible. Ronnie O'Sullivan marked the 40th anniversary of one of the most iconic breaks in World Snooker Championship history with a special one of his own. O'Sullivan will face Judd Trump in the eighth Crucible final of his gilded 30-year career on Sunday and Monday courtesy of a dominant 17-11 win over four-time world champion John Higgins in the semi-finals on Saturday evening.
John Higgins says Ronnie O'Sullivan was 'lethal' while he was scrapping about for much of the tournament, after losing their semi-final 17-11 tonight.
